By Product Type
Sheet Molding Compound:
Sheet Molding Compound (SMC) is a versatile product type that is widely utilized in the automotive and electrical industries due to its excellent mechanical properties and ease of processing. SMC is known for its high strength-to-weight ratio, making it ideal for applications where reducing weight is critical. The SMC market is driven by the growing demand for durable and lightweight components in automotive body panels and electrical enclosures. Additionally, the ability to mold complex shapes and achieve smooth surface finishes makes SMC a preferred choice for manufacturers. As more companies seek to optimize production processes and reduce costs, the adoption of SMC is expected to rise, contributing significantly to the overall MMC resin market growth. The ongoing innovations in SMC formulations aimed at enhancing performance and sustainability will also play a crucial role in shaping this segment's future.
Bulk Molding Compound:
Bulk Molding Compound (BMC) is another essential product type within the MMC resin market, recognized for its excellent electrical insulation properties and impact resistance. BMC is particularly favored in the electrical and electronics sectors, where reliable insulation and durability are paramount. The increasing use of BMC in manufacturing electrical components, such as connectors and housings, serves as a significant growth driver for this segment. Moreover, the rising demand for high-performance materials in automotive applications further enhances the market potential for BMC. With continuous advancements in production techniques, manufacturers are also exploring new formulations of BMC that offer improved thermal stability and lower environmental impact. Consequently, the Bulk Molding Compound segment is expected to witness robust growth in the coming years, supported by evolving industry requirements.

Prepreg:
Prepreg, or pre-impregnated composite fibers, are revolutionizing the MMC resin market due to their superior properties, including exceptional strength and lightweight attributes. This product type is extensively used in the aerospace and automotive sectors, where performance and weight reduction are crucial. The growing trend of using composite materials in these industries is driving the demand for prepreg, as they facilitate the production of high-quality components with enhanced mechanical performance. Furthermore, the advancements in prepreg technologies, such as the development of eco-friendly resins and faster curing methods, are likely to spur market growth. As manufacturers increasingly focus on sustainable practices and high-performance materials, the role of prepreg in the MMC resin market will continue to expand, presenting new opportunities for growth.

By Ingredient Type
Glass Fiber:
Glass fiber is one of the primary ingredient types used in MMC resins, appreciated for its high strength and durability. Its lightweight characteristics make it an ideal choice for various applications, especially in the automotive and aerospace industries, where minimizing weight is essential. The incorporation of glass fiber in resin formulations enhances mechanical properties and thermal resistance, making it suitable for high-stress applications. As the demand for high-performance materials continues to rise, the glass fiber segment is expected to witness significant growth. Furthermore, the ongoing developments in glass fiber technologies aimed at improving environmental sustainability and reducing costs will further boost its adoption in the MMC resin market.
Carbon Fiber:
Carbon fiber is another crucial ingredient type in the MMC resin market, renowned for its exceptional strength-to-weight ratio and stiffness. As industries increasingly prioritize lightweight materials without compromising strength, carbon fiber is becoming a preferred choice for high-performance applications in aerospace, automotive, and sports equipment. Although carbon fiber composites tend to be more expensive than other materials, the demand for advanced composites in critical applications is driving growth in this segment. The continuous advancements in carbon fiber manufacturing processes aimed at reducing costs and improving mechanical properties are expected to enhance its market penetration. As the market evolves, carbon fiber will play a pivotal role in expanding the capabilities and applications of MMC resins.
